Former Mass. EMT pleads guilty to tampering with 3 fentanyl citrate vials




From March 2020 to early October 2020, Mangan worked as a part-time EMT. Around Sept. 30, Magnan removed fentanyl citrate from three vials and replaced the majority of the contents with saline. Magnan had only left 4.4%, 6.8%, and 24.2% of the concentration of fentanyl citrate in the vials. She was charged on June 24, 2022.

Chief nurse at Keys air ambulance was stealing drugs at work




The former chief flight nurse for the Florida Keys air ambulance program Trauma Star stole morphine and a potent sedative while on the job and tried to cover it up by manipulating records, the Monroe County Sheriff’s Office said Tuesday.

Former Denver paramedic accused of fentanyl theft




A former Denver Health paramedic was indicted by a grand jury after being accused of stealing 50 vials of fentanyl and tampering with another 20 over the last four years.

Former paramedic sentenced for stealing fentanyl, replacing with saline

HUNTSVILLE, Ala. – A former supervisory paramedic has been sentenced to 51 months in federal prison. A federal judge sentenced Michael Greenhaw, 43, of Arab, on Tuesday.
